Eef Barzelay

Rocket Science Original Motion Picture Soundtrack

2008-04-28

A charming soundtrack that compliments the film’s awkward struggle in life as a teenager (an even more clever Napoleon Dynamite, with all the awkward and hysterical laughs). Mostly composed of snippets straight from the film, there are some actual composed pieces of music that are fitting with the movies’ character’s interchanges. Check out tracks 2 “Fight Song Melodies”, The Violent Femmes’ track 11 “Kiss Off”, track 16 “I Love The Unknown”, and track 21 “Girls Don’t Care”.
